2. The app: we receive nothing

Shopify2SimplyPrint is self-hosted. When you deploy it, it runs in your own Cloudflare account, stores its data in your own Cloudflare D1 database, and talks directly to your Shopify store and your SimplyPrint account.

No data is sent to us at any point. There is no shared backend, no telemetry, no analytics inside the app, and no account with us. We could not access your store data even if we wanted to.

Data the app stores in your own database, under your control, includes your Shopify domain and access token, your SimplyPrint API key (encrypted at rest with a key you generate), product mappings, print queue history and sync logs. Because you host it, you are the data controller for all of it, including any obligations you have to your own customers.

You can verify all of this: the complete source is published on GitHub under the GPLv3.
